According to a National Institute of Health survey, roughly 92% of adults between the ages of 20 and 64 have experienced tooth decay in their lifetime. As such, dentists regularly provide fillings to eliminate oral health issues and save natural teeth. If you’re concerned about your smile or think you may have a cavity, here are a few signs that you might need a filling.

How to Know When You Need a Filling

1. You Have Tooth Pain

When your tooth is decaying, you’re likely going to experience on-going pain. Some individuals become sensitive to hot and cold foods, feel a throbbing pain when chewing, or have pressure or discomfort when consuming sugary foods.

2. Your Teeth Have Visibly Changed

FillingWhile many cavities are invisible to the naked eye, some dental patients in need of a filling observe physical changes to their tooth. This can include brown spots, a visible hole, or a rough, chipped area. As you go about your oral hygiene routine, pay attention if floss continues to tear or get stuck around a particular tooth, or if food lingers in one specific area. 

3. You’ve Experienced Dental Trauma

While tooth decay is the primary reason to get a dental filling, fractured teeth can also be restored using this treatment option. Thus, if you’ve endured a dental trauma that caused chips, cracks, or fractures to a tooth, your dentist may opt to use a filling. This will help maintain the strength, shape, and functionality of that tooth.

4. You Grind Your Teeth

Bruxism, or teeth grinding, slowly wears down the enamel on your teeth and can change the overall shape of them. Fillings are one way to restore teeth that have been impacted by this habit. During your visit, your dentist may also provide dental accessories like a custom mouthguard to protect your teeth from the effects of grinding in the future.
